### CI note: green pool health checks flaking on Tallyhook billing worker

If the blue-green deploy stalls at "waiting for green healthy," it's almost always the warmup probe timing out before the billing worker finishes loading rate tables. Bump the probe delay, don't restart the pipeline — restarting orphans the green pool and ops gets grumpy. The fix landed in the build referenced by the token below.

pipeline stamp: htk31_f769b577b3028a4e9958e5bb8d1259a

## v2.4.1 — Canary Gating

- Gating rules for Driftbeacon canary deploys now evaluate plugin-emitted health signals.
- Plugins must declare a health endpoint in their manifest; missing endpoints block promotion.
- Override window shortened to 15 minutes.
- Removed legacy pass-through gate for unsigned plugins.
- Breaking: gate config schema v1 no longer accepted. Plugin compatibility questions should be directed to the maintainer named below.

account owner for bawip-tahag: Raleth Quenok

# Wavelark preview service — env file
# Renders audio waveform previews for the Tidepool upload pipeline.
# If previews stall, check the render pool first, then this file.
# All values below are safe to share except the transcoder credential.
# Restart the worker after any edit. The credential line follows immediately.

vault entry, kafog-yahop: COURIER_KEY8=0faa53ae